The only "undies" I have ever seen allowed on the team girls are nude colored spankies (that's the dance term, I'm not sure what the gym term is...). They're not regular underwear but are meant to go under leos. In dance they are usually colored and meant to go under costumes when the girls don't wear leos or their leos are nude (so it doesn't appear as if the girls are naked when they kick their legs up high).
